It wasn’t until I got my first energy bill that reflected a full month of being at home, that I realized my energy bill had risen. I couldn’t believe that my HVAC usage had gone up that much. I called the HVAC company and I told them about the energy bill. I was surprised when he told me that when you don’t have Zone Control and you are using the HVAC systems an additional ten hours a day, it was common to see an energy spike. You couldn’t get all of that extra heating and air conditioning without having some repercussions. They suggested I have Zone Control installed into my home. With Zone Control, I would only be running the HVAC in the rooms that I was using. I wouldn’t be heating or cooling the entire home. The cost of Zone Control was small when compared to how much my energy bill was going up.
